Governor’s Office Police Officer Injured, As Mob Attempt To Break Into Oyo Secretariat Over Fuel, Naira Scarcity

In what looked like an angry protest in Ibadan, the capital city of Oyo state, angry mob todashly raged to the Oyo state Secretariat and forcing their way into the premises as security personnel who appeared to have been caught unaware at the entrance scampered for safety.

Consequently, one police officer who is a detail at the Oyo state Governor’s Office by the name, Inspector Dynasty Layemo was injured by the mob who attempted to gain access into the Governor’s Office.

The police officer has since been taken to an undisclosed hospital for immediate medical attention.

Some of the angry youths were heard shouting out of frustration in Yoruba language, “lori owo was” which translates despite being our money.

The shocking incident left many civil servants inside the government Secretariat in panic mood as many were seen hanging around different spots in case of unforseen eventuality.

There were burning of Tyres in front of the state Secretariat by the angry mob to register their anger.

The Executive Assistant on security to Governor Seyi Makinde, CP Sunday Odukoya (rtd), who spoke to journalists condemned the act saying the situation in the country affects everybody equally and should not be reason why anybody should hide under such to destroy or vandalize Government properties.

However, security personnel comprising Operation Burst, NSCDC, and Amotekun have arrested the situation as the mob were dispersed and normalcy restored within the state Secretariat.
